  • Yang Xinhai was a Chinese serial killer who confessed to committing 67 murders and 23 rapes between 1999 and 2003.

    He was sentenced to death and executed.

    He was dubbed the "Monster Killer" by the media. He was the most prolific known serial killer in China since the establishment of the People's Republic of China in 1949.
